The Joma Slam Pro 2.0 black and turquoise stands out for its exceptional balance between power and control in a diamond-shaped frame. What immediately caught my attention during research was its advanced vibration reduction system, which reduces vibrations by up to 40% - a significant technological advantage for players seeking comfort without compromising performance. The 3K carbon fiber construction combined with the black EVA core creates a racket that delivers impressive power while maintaining precise control, making this 2025 model a worthy upgrade in Joma's premium line.
How it plays..
Balanced Power With Precision Control
On court, the Joma Slam Pro 2.0 immediately impresses with its light weight (355-365g) and balanced feel. Despite its diamond shape, it doesn't demand the extreme technique typically associated with such rackets. The sweet spot is generous and forgiving, especially considering its shape, and offers excellent feedback on contact. The medium-hard touch provides that satisfying "thwack" on solid hits without sending vibrations up your arm. Players who prioritize versatility will appreciate how it transitions between offensive power shots and controlled defensive play without missing a beat. The 38mm profile strikes an ideal balance - thick enough for stability but not so bulky that it sacrifices maneuverability.
Defense
Reliable Defense With Excellent Lob Control
From the baseline, the Slam Pro 2.0 offers reliable defensive capabilities that belie its diamond shape. When under pressure, the racket delivers precise lobs with good depth and height control - a testament to its balanced design approach. The carbon construction provides enough stiffness to return hard-hit balls without feeling overwhelmed, while the vibration reduction system keeps your arm fresh during extended defensive exchanges. While some users note it could offer slightly better ball output in defensive blocks, the overall control and response when resetting points is impressive. If defensive play is a significant part of your game, you'll find this racket more accommodating than most diamond-shaped options.
Attack
Commanding Power For Aggressive Players
This is where the Slam Pro 2.0 truly shines. The diamond shape combined with quality carbon construction delivers excellent power generation with minimal effort. Smashes come off the face with impressive velocity and placement accuracy, making this racket particularly lethal for finishing points. The stiff response from the 3K carbon faces translates your swing energy efficiently into ball speed without excessive vibration. What separates this from pure power rackets is the level of control you maintain even at high swing speeds - you can hit with confidence knowing the ball will land where you aim. For attacking players who value controlled aggression over raw power, this racket offers an excellent balance.
Netplay
Exceptional Net Play Precision
At the net, the Joma Slam Pro 2.0 demonstrates why it's highly rated by advanced players. Its balance allows for quick reaction times and easy shot acceleration during fast exchanges. Volleys feel crisp and responsive with excellent directional control, while the vibration reduction system ensures comfort during extended net play. The racket particularly excels in bandejas and vÃboras, where its spin potential and control really shine. The diamond shape provides enough power to put away short balls without overwhelming your touch on more delicate shots. Players who spend significant time at the net will appreciate how this racket enhances both aggressive kills and subtle placement volleys.
Our Advice for New Players
Consider Your Learning Curve
If you're a beginner, I'd recommend approaching the Slam Pro 2.0 with caution. Its diamond shape and medium-hard touch require a level of technique that might frustrate those still developing their fundamentals. While the balanced design is more forgiving than pure power rackets, it still demands proper form to unlock its full potential. If you're determined to invest in a racket you can grow into, this could work - but be prepared for an adjustment period. For most beginners, I'd recommend starting with a more forgiving round-shaped option until your technique is more established, then considering this as your skills advance.
Our Advice for Intermediate Players
A Performance Upgrade For Developing Players
For intermediate players looking to elevate their game, the Slam Pro 2.0 offers significant advantages. If you've mastered the basics and are ready for a racket that rewards good technique, this model hits the sweet spot between performance and accessibility. The balanced design helps smooth the transition to a more advanced racket without overwhelming you. You'll particularly benefit if your game emphasizes net play and controlled attacking shots. High-intermediate players with decent swing mechanics will find this racket immediately enhances power without sacrificing the control needed to continue developing. The vibration reduction system also helps prevent fatigue as you push through longer, more intense matches.
Competitive level
Versatile Performance For Competitive Play
Advanced players will appreciate the Slam Pro 2.0 for its versatility in competitive settings. The diamond shape provides the power needed for decisive finishing shots, while the balanced design maintains enough control for strategic play. At this level, you'll notice how the carbon construction and EVA core work together to enhance shot placement precision, especially in high-pressure situations. The racket particularly rewards technical players who value shot variety over one-dimensional power. If your game involves frequent position switching and adapting to different opponents, the all-round capabilities make this an excellent tournament choice. The performance-to-price ratio also makes it an attractive option even for advanced players who might typically consider more expensive models.
